What Are Laser Hair Caps and How Do They Work?

Laser hair caps use low-level laser therapy (LLLT) to help hair grow. LLLT is a safe way to treat hair loss. It uses red light to help hair grow back.

The Science Behind Red Light Therapy (650-680nm Wavelengths)

Red light therapy is key to laser hair caps. It’s proven to help hair grow. The light used is absorbed by the scalp, boosting blood flow and reducing inflammation.

This creates a healthy environment for hair to grow. It leads to thicker, fuller hair. Clinical studies show laser hair caps really work, making them a good choice for hair loss.

Step-by-Step Guide to Using Laser Hair Caps

To get the most out of your laser hair cap, knowing how to use it is key. Using a red light cap for hair right means paying attention to the details and sticking to a routine.

Proper Scalp Preparation

Before you start with your laser therapy cap, make sure your scalp is clean. Wash it with a mild shampoo and dry it well. This step helps the laser hair cap work better on your scalp.

Correct Positioning and Usage Technique

Put the laser hair cap on your head, making sure it fits right and covers the bald spots. The azza laser hair caps are made for comfort and easy use. Adjust the cap to get even coverage.

Recommended Treatment Protocol

For the best results, use your laser therapy cap for 15 to 20 minutes, three times a week. Being consistent is important with laser hair caps. Keep to your treatment plan to help hair grow.

FAQ

What is a laser cap for hair growth?

A laser cap for hair growth is a non-invasive device. It uses red light therapy to help hair grow and stay healthy. It sends out low-level laser or LEDs to promote hair regrowth.

How do laser hair caps work for hair loss?

Laser hair caps send out red light at a specific wavelength. This light is absorbed by the scalp, which stimulates hair growth. This process is called red light therapy or low-level laser therapy (LLLT).

Are laser hair caps clinically proven to work?

Yes, many studies show laser hair caps can help hair grow. They can increase hair count and thickness. In some cases, they have an 85% success rate.

How long does it take to see results from using a laser hair cap?

Results can vary, but most see improvements in 3-6 months. The best results come after 6-12 months of use.

How often should I use my laser hair cap?

Use your laser hair cap 3 times a week for 15-20 minutes. Consistency is key for the best results.

Are there any side effects associated with using a laser hair cap?

Laser hair caps are generally safe and have few side effects. Some users might experience mild scalp irritation or redness. These effects are usually temporary and go away on their own.
